Job Description - Graduate Trainee Sales Account Manager - Life Sciences
An exciting opportunity with excellent career growth potential for an organised, target driven and self-motivated Biology, Biomedical or Business/Marketing graduate. This is an ideal opportunity for a motivated individual looking to build a career in sales.
The key responsibilities are to:
- Develop relationship with the customers
- Prospect for new business
- Understand customer needs and preferences and send customised product offers
- Make phone calls to the existing customers to better understand their needs
- Follow up leads
- Update the CRM database with the relevant sales information
- Keep abreast about the latest developments in the IVD market area
- Create spreadsheets and information packs containing the relevant scientific data and information and provide it to the customers
- Prepare quotes
- Manage and follow-up Sales Opportunities to ensure they move through the funnel in a timely manner
- Organize and execute sales presentations
- Provide fantastic customer service to our clients
- Liaise with Scientists in-house and at external organisations
- Track, collate and interpret sales figures
- Forecast annual, quarterly and monthly sales revenue
- Generate timely sales reports
- Methodically document communications with the customers in customer relationship management (CRM) database
- Provide after-sales service
